Transaction 88884d178781c58bd6f2e8dd3bf2ed04a69d49dd7cf2f18476af9117ceacc92f
1 Input
1 Output
-
88884d178781c58bd6f2e8dd3bf2ed04a69d49dd7cf2f18476af9117ceacc92f:0
- value
- 21079560
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 27e579ac2139efb5eea2a412a3355c0361e6b3df OP_EQUALVERIFY OP_CHECKSIG
- address
- 14dxFhokVb62fvPaZLhTssYXu9Pf5E7z2V